Transaction 39763036fd80dbee3b5de6542bfcd9ddb4fc34c77aa6c00f71c634017568fd21

1 Input
2 Outputs
  • 39763036fd80dbee3b5de6542bfcd9ddb4fc34c77aa6c00f71c634017568fd21:0
  • value  124912629
    address  1EsdVgCrr9XmBgow6453Czoxw92urRJkmC
  • 39763036fd80dbee3b5de6542bfcd9ddb4fc34c77aa6c00f71c634017568fd21:1
  • value  23932291
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n